About Michelle

Michelle Evans is a Licensed Professional Counselor (LPC) who focuses on stress, anxiety, trauma and abuse, self-esteem, and addictions. She brings 18 years of counseling experience to sessions and aims to make therapy straightforward and useful. Michelle explains things plainly and helps people find tools that fit their daily life.

Her approach is collaborative and adaptable. She uses client-centered methods to listen and shape sessions around each person’s needs.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) and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T) are among the practical tools she draws on to address patterns of thinking, emotion regulation, and impulsivity.

02

How Michelle works

Michelle has worked in a range of settings since earning a Master of Arts in Counseling from Webster University in 2006. Her background includes residential programs, independent living homes, foster care–related services, and substance use treatment contexts. That variety informs how she tailors interventions to different life situations.

Sessions often focus on concrete skills - coping strategies, relapse prevention planning, communication techniques, and mindfulness exercises. She also addresses relationship patterns such as attachment, abandonment, codependency, and blended family stress in an individualized way. Motivational Interviewing is used when people want help with change and commitment issues.

Michelle is licensed in Missouri as an LPC and holds a Washington Licensed Mental Health Counselor credential (LMHC). She offers sessions in English and works with people who prefer multiple formats of online counseling.

How Michelle Uses Practical Approaches Online

Michelle often combines Client-Centered Therapy,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T), and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T) when working with people online. Client-Centered Therapy focuses on listening and shaping sessions around each person's priorities, helping them feel understood and heard. CBT looks at thinking patterns and helps people test and change thoughts and behaviors that feed anxiety, low self-esteem, or addictive urges. DBT emphasizes emotion regulation, distress tolerance, and interpersonal effectiveness skills for people dealing with strong emotions or impulsivity.

Finding the right approach is part of the work. Michelle will collaborate with each person to choose methods that match their goals, needs, and daily life. She adapts tools over time and checks in to see what is helping and what needs to change.

Online formats include video calls, phone sessions, live chat, and text-based messaging. Video allows face-to-face conversation and skills practice. Phone sessions can be good for lower bandwidth or for shorter check-ins. Live chat and text messaging work for people who prefer written exchanges or need flexible ways to stay connected between longer sessions. These options make it easier to fit counseling into work, school, and caregiving routines.
